Beyond the translation

Song interpretation

This classic sensual duet expresses romantic longing, anticipation, and deep intimate affection between two lovers. The lyrics use vivid imagery of nature, musical instruments, and poetic metaphors like the rare Kurinji flower nectar and the melody of the Veena to convey passion, bashfulness, and the eagerness to unite.

Writing craft

Poetic devices

Uvamaani / Metaphor (Uvamai)

Kurunchi malaril Valintha rasaththai Urunja thudikum udhadu irukka

Comparing the lips yearning for romance to siphoning sweet nectar from the rare Kurinji flower.

Metaphor (Uvamai)

Analil mezhugoo Alai kadalil thaan Alaiyum padagooo

Comparing the lover's restless, anxious mind to wax melting over fire and a boat drifting in a stormy ocean.

Rhetorical Question (Vina)

Odiyathenna Poovizhthal moodiyathenna

Using rhetorical questions like 'Odiyathenna' and 'Poovizhthal moodiyathenna' to emphasize the playfulness and longing in romance.

Musical Metaphor

Unathu ragam uthayam aagum Iniya veenai nann

Comparing the female protagonist to a sweet Veena waiting for the musician's fingers to play harmonious ragas.

Did you know?

Trivia

This romantic song is composed by Ilaiyaraaja and penned by Vaali for the 1979 film 'Azhage Unnai Aarathikkiren' starring Kamal Haasan and Latha, sung beautifully by S. P. Balasubrahmanyam and Vani Jairam.
